 2. Trim Levels & Configuration Options

The 2026 Range Rover comes in multiple trims, each catering to different performance and luxury needs:

πŸ”Ή SE (Base)

Entry-level luxury trim

Standard comfort and technology

Estimated starting around $107,400 in the U.S. 



πŸ”Ή Autobiography

Enhanced luxury features like massaging seats, premium leather, advanced infotainment

Higher performance hybrid powertrain options

MSRP around $161,350 in the U.S. 


πŸ”Ή SV (Special Vehicle)

Tailored, high-performance versions

More dynamic tuning and bespoke design elements

MSRP from roughly $221,650 in the U.S. 


πŸ”Ή SV Black

Exclusive top-end luxury with carbon-black styling and premium leather

MSRP from around $241,050 in the U.S. 


Trim levels may vary by market and may include Long Wheelbase (LWB), standard wheelbase, and various powertrain choices.

 3. Engine Options & Performance:



        The 2026 Range Rover caters to different driving preferences:

πŸ”Έ Hybrid & Mild Hybrid

3.0L Inline-6 with mild hybrid assistance

Around 356–434 hp, quick acceleration and improved efficiency

0-100 km/h (~0-62 mph) in ~5.7-6.2 seconds depending on tuning 


πŸ”Έ Plug-in Hybrid (PHEV)

Combines electric drive with a gasoline engine

More efficiency and short electric-only range

Strong power and smooth acceleration 


πŸ”Έ V8 Options

Powerful 4.4L V8 with around 523–525 hp

Excellent torque and high-speed performance

Classic Range Rover character with strong presence on highway and off-road 


All versions come standard with all-wheel drive, adaptive suspension, luxury interiors, and advanced safety systems.

 5. Price Around the World (2026 Model)

    Prices vary significantly by region due to taxes, duties, and market preferences. Here’s a breakdown of typical Range Rover pricing for the 2026 model (all approximate):

🌍 United States:

SE: ~from $107,400

Autobiography: ~$161,350

SV: ~$221,650

SV Black: ~$241,050 


πŸ‡ͺπŸ‡Ί Europe:

HSE P360: €144,500 ($170,600)

HSE P400 & P460e trims: €146,000 – €155,800 ($172,500 – $183,900)

Autobiography: €164,100 ($193,700) 


πŸ‡΄πŸ‡² Oman (Muscat):

SE P360: OMR 56,490 – 58,000

Autobiography trims: OMR 72,200 – 89,000

SV Editions: up to OMR 108,700 – 119,000 


πŸ‡ΆπŸ‡¦ Qatar:

4.4T First Edition: QAR 515,600 ($141,700) 


πŸ‡°πŸ‡Ό Kuwait:

 Note: Prices include base vehicle cost but may exclude destination charges, taxes, and options, which vary by country.
